Angan-Angan Harsa is an energetic exploration of moments of joy, set in the familiar landscapes of photographer Farid Renais Ghimas’ birthplace, Bengkulu—a province on the southwest coast of Sumatra Island, Indonesia. Documented in the summer of 2022, this series portrays the artist’s family, friends, and community members as protagonists in a visual narrative that reflects the rhythms of everyday life. Through quiet moments of connection at home, the carefree laughter of loved ones, and the timeless simplicity of afternoons spent outdoors, the photographs celebrate the beauty of the mundane and the relationships that define both personal and collective identity.
Angan-Angan Harsa started as a final university project during the artist’s MA at Central Saint Martins in 2022. Initially created as a photobook for the final submission, it was later reworked and published by Jordan, jordan Édition in 2024, following discussions that began in 2023. Meaning “Dreams of Joy” in Indonesian, the project draws upon fragments of Farid’s childhood memories and experiences in Bengkulu, manifesting them through photographs that reveal how the place looks today. The book invites the viewers to reflect on the connections between people, place, and memory, offering a personal yet universal story of belonging.
